Abcourt Mines Inc. (CVE:ABI - Get Free Report) was up 66.7% during mid-day trading on Saturday . The stock traded as high as C$0.08 and last traded at C$0.08. Approximately 8,814,002 shares traded h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 1,957% from the average daily volume of 428,392 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$0.05.

Abcourt Mines Stock Performance

The company has a market cap of C$59.96 million, a P/E ratio of -4.56 and a beta of 1.57. The stock's 50-day moving average is C$0.05 and its two-hundred day moving average is C$0.05.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of -32.13, a current ratio of 0.67 and a quick ratio of 0.44.

Abcourt Mines Inc engages in the acquisition, exploration, evaluation, and exploitation of gold mining properties in Canada. It also explores for silver and zinc deposits. Abcourt Mines Inc was incorporated in 1971 and is headquartered in Rouyn-Noranda, Canada.
